  • Breaking the Rules of Fashion with Kaelah of Little Chief Honey Bee! Part 3

    Hey guys! Im Kaelah from Little Chief Honey Bee and I am back for our final installment of how to tastefully bend some fashion rules!
     
     
    Let's just teleport to the nearest music festival like Bonnaroo or Coachella. We can lounge on the grass and listen to music that makes us feel like we're back in the 70's. This dress features a pattern straight from the psychedelic era and it offers no apologies! How do you wear something so bright and vivid from a very specific time all the while trying to make it work for the here and now? Instead of getting wrapped up in the circular sunglasses, braided headbands and dream-catcher earrings, I'm going to attempt to make it more modern while keeping the most color possible!
     
     
    1) The print on the dress is over the top, that's no secret. I tried to keep it daytime appropriate by adding a sage colored cardigan which can be worn in any of the 4 seasons. The sage helps balance the browns and yellows of the dress, while still remaining colorful and fun.
     
     
    2) Go for a structured handbag. It's easy to fall into a slouchy boho bag or tote for this kind of outfit. They just seem to work well together. Instead, pick a pop color for the print and go for something with buckles and flaps! You can still keep it simple while looking like it's actually on purpose!
     
     
    3) Do something fun with your shoes! I wouldn't necessarily recommend these for galavanting around festival grounds, but I've seen stranger things worn! From the knees down the shoes look like a statement piece, but when you see the whole package you realize they're much calmer than you first thought!
     
     
    4) Keep it solid. This goes against practically every fashion rule I have for myself, but that's just my style! I love to pair the most clashing prints together, but sometimes it really works to just keep it simple. In this case the dress is so fun, vibrant and overwhelming that it's more effective to block off chunks of color to make it memorable.
     
     
    Be very deliberate about what pieces you want to make a statement. In any other situation, each of these pieces out without a doubt be an attention grabber, but they don't look too over the top when they're all put together. It's all about proportion, hue and placement!

  • Erin Wasson in Elle France June 2011

    In a stunning editorial for Elle France, model Erin Wasson worked with photographer Fred Meylan to create beautiful bohemian images.  Featuring denim, leather fringe and maxis, this shoot was exactly what I needed for some midweek inspiration. Take a look below for some of the best images!
     
     
     I love the rustic background with the contrast of a maxi and tousled hair.

     70's bohemian style with a perfect oversized cardigan and hat.

    I love leather shorts paired with a vintage tee. So perfect for summer. 

     Fringed pants that only Wasson could pull off! In a vintage car with red interior, this is definitely a rad picture!

  • How Dita Does Coachella

    Dita Von Teese, queen of burlesque and hot retro style, took in the sights and sounds of this year's Coachella Valley Music and Arts Festival.

    Dita spent the three-day event looking flawless in a variety of outfits that adapted retro glamour for life under a sunny desert sky.

    (Left): I am in love with Dita's nautical-style, high-waisted trousers. Her updo is also rockin', managing a put-together look that is also casual.

     

    (Above): From the mary jane wedges to the layers of bangles, this is Dita's awesome version of boho beauty. I love all the earthy tones on that tropical print dress!


    (Above): Ladylike charm is what it's all about in this look. Soft satin ruffles, that polished hat and a pretty chain purse keep Dita looking elegant. Psssst, recognize that lovely lady with her? Yep, it's Katy Perry looking day-glo pretty.
